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ascending Plane

The fundamental principle driving this style of game is based on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means the outcome of each round is not predetermined but is instead determined algorithmically, and the integrity of the process can be independently verified. The RNG determines the multiplier at which the plane will ā€œcrash,ā€ or descend, ending the betting round. Before each round, a seed value is generated; this seed, combined with a server seed, produces the outcome. Players can often verify the fairness of the game by examining these seeds. This transparency builds trust and assures them that the game isn't rigged.

The multiplier isn’t a linear progression. It begins to climb slowly, but as the altitude increases, the rate of increase accelerates, offering the potential for significantly higher payouts. This exponential growth is what drives the excitement and the temptation to hold on for as long as possible. However, it’s this same exponential growth that also increases the risk. The longer you wait, the closer you get to the inevitable crash, and the greater the likelihood of losing your entire bet. Successfully navigating this dynamic relies on understanding probability and managing your risk effectively.

The Evolution of Provably Fair Gaming

The concept of "provably fair" gaming has become increasingly important in the online gambling industry. Initially, players had to rely on the integrity of the gaming operator to ensure fairness. The advent of cryptographic technologies has enabled the development of systems that allow players to independently verify the randomness of each game outcome. This is achieved through the use of seed values, hashing algorithms, and transparent verification tools. The aviator game, and similar experiences, often utilize these technologies to build trust and transparency with their users.

The evolution of provably fair gaming has significant implications for the industry. It empowers players with greater control and accountability, reducing the potential for manipulation or fraud. It also fosters a more competitive environment, as operators are incentivized to adopt fair and transparent practices to attract and retain customers. As blockchain technology continues to mature, we can expect to see even more sophisticated and secure provably fair gaming solutions emerge, further enhancing the trustworthiness and integrity of the online gambling experience. The move towards verifiable fairness is a direct response to player demands for greater transparency.
